aren't HID conversions illegal in the US?

No. They would simply need to meet Federal and/or local regulations for automotive lighting.

And those regulations say, in short.. HID is allowed in a car, if it came from the factory that way. Otherwise, it is not DOT approved.

Lots of people do it -- doesn't mean it's legal tho.

I've only gone through the lighting regs in a cursory manner. I just looked up an HID conversion company, and you're right. They only sell their kits for "exhibition" or "show" purposes.

Seems rather silly. People are using DOT approved non-HID lighting kits all the time. As long as it's done correctly.....
